di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index cce4be0f92d4abd6344f61541335d9e8f7b97da9..c97acd1628e7816e70d7791d5702f4dcf4680c42 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-378,6 +378,13 @@ deploy-uc4-load-generator: JAVA_PROJECT_NAME: "uc4-load-generator" JAVA_PROJECT_DEPS: "load-generator-commons" +deploy-http-bridge: + extends: .deploy-benchmarks + variables: + IMAGE_NAME: "theodolite-http-bridge" + JAVA_PROJECT_NAME: "http-bridge" + JAVA_PROJECT_DEPS: "load-generator-commons" + .smoketest-benchmarks: stage: smoketest extends: diff --git a/theodolite-benchmarks/http-bridge/Dockerfile b/theodolite-benchmarks/http-bridge/Dockerfile new file mode 100644 index 0000000000000000000000000000000000000000..b31dbcdef48f3b9eadf81a35c95e441c4b54955b --- /dev/null +++ b/theodolite-benchmarks/http-bridge/Dockerfile @@ -0,0 +1,6 @@ +FROM openjdk:11-slim + +ADD build/distributions/http-bridge.tar / + +CMD JAVA_OPTS="$JAVA_OPTS -Dorg.slf4j.simpleLogger.defaultLogLevel=$LOG_LEVEL" \ + /http-bridge/bin/http-bridge \ No newline at end of file